projects
/
openwrt
/
openwrt.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
ramips: simplify EX2700 network config
[openwrt/openwrt.git]
/
target
/
linux
/
ramips
/
base-files
/
etc
/
board.d
/
02_network
diff --git
a/target/linux/ramips/base-files/etc/board.d/02_network
b/target/linux/ramips/base-files/etc/board.d/02_network
index bf31c2af931d9b8fa104bdace84657ad8fe89466..2d8d8edc29d4a027220b56e18537e2390c87e491 100755
(executable)
--- a/
target/linux/ramips/base-files/etc/board.d/02_network
+++ b/
target/linux/ramips/base-files/etc/board.d/02_network
@@
-24,8
+24,7
@@
ramips_setup_rt3x5x_vlans()
lanports="$port:lan $lanports"
fi
done
lanports="$port:lan $lanports"
fi
done
- ucidef_set_interfaces_lan_wan "eth0.1" "eth0.2"
- ucidef_add_switch "rt305x" $lanports $wanports "6@eth0"
+ ucidef_add_switch "rt305x" $lanports $wanports "6t@eth0"
}
ramips_setup_interfaces()
}
ramips_setup_interfaces()
@@
-33,6
+32,11
@@
ramips_setup_interfaces()
local board="$1"
case $board in
local board="$1"
case $board in
+ 11acnas|\
+ w2914nsv2)
+ ucidef_add_switch "switch0" \
+ "0:lan:4" "1:lan:3" "2:lan:2" "3:lan:1" "4:wan:5" "6@eth0"
+ ;;
3g150b|\
3g300m|\
a5-v11|\
3g150b|\
3g300m|\
a5-v11|\
@@
-49,19
+53,24
@@
ramips_setup_interfaces()
microwrt|\
mpr-a2|\
ncs601w|\
microwrt|\
mpr-a2|\
ncs601w|\
+ omega2 | \
+ omega2p | \
+ timecloud|\
w150m|\
w150m|\
+ widora-neo|\
wnce2001|\
wnce2001|\
+ zbt-cpe102|\
zte-q7)
ucidef_add_switch "switch0"
ucidef_add_switch_attr "switch0" "enable" "false"
ucidef_set_interface_lan "eth0"
;;
zte-q7)
ucidef_add_switch "switch0"
ucidef_add_switch_attr "switch0" "enable" "false"
ucidef_set_interface_lan "eth0"
;;
- 3g-6200nl|\
mlw221|\
mr-102n)
ucidef_set_interface_lan "eth0.2"
;;
3g-6200n|\
mlw221|\
mr-102n)
ucidef_set_interface_lan "eth0.2"
;;
3g-6200n|\
+ ac1200pro|\
ai-br100|\
db-wrt01|\
dir-300-b7|\
ai-br100|\
db-wrt01|\
dir-300-b7|\
@@
-70,32
+79,43
@@
ramips_setup_interfaces()
dir-615-h1|\
firewrt|\
hlk-rm04|\
dir-615-h1|\
firewrt|\
hlk-rm04|\
+ mac1200rv2|\
miwifi-mini|\
miwifi-nano|\
mt7621|\
mt7628|\
mzk-750dhp|\
mzk-w300nh2|\
miwifi-mini|\
miwifi-nano|\
mt7621|\
mt7628|\
mzk-750dhp|\
mzk-w300nh2|\
+ nixcore|\
oy-0001|\
pbr-m1|\
psg1208|\
oy-0001|\
pbr-m1|\
psg1208|\
+ psg1218|\
sap-g3200u3|\
sk-wb8|\
sap-g3200u3|\
sk-wb8|\
+ vr500|\
wf-2881|\
wf-2881|\
- whr-300hp2|\
- whr-600d|\
witi|\
witi|\
+ wl-wn575a3|\
wndr3700v5|\
wndr3700v5|\
- wsr-1166|\
- wsr-600|\
wt1520|\
y1|\
wt1520|\
y1|\
+ youku-yk1|\
+ zbt-ape522ii|\
+ zbt-we826|\
zbt-wg2626|\
zbt-wg3526|\
zbt-wg2626|\
zbt-wg3526|\
-
youku-yk1
)
+
zbt-wr8305rt
)
ucidef_add_switch "switch0" \
"0:lan" "1:lan" "2:lan" "3:lan" "4:wan" "6@eth0"
;;
ucidef_add_switch "switch0" \
"0:lan" "1:lan" "2:lan" "3:lan" "4:wan" "6@eth0"
;;
+ whr-300hp2|\
+ whr-600d|\
+ wsr-1166|\
+ wsr-600)
+ ucidef_add_switch "switch0" \
+ "0:lan:1" "1:lan:2" "2:lan:3" "3:lan:4" "4:wan:5" "6@eth0"
+ ;;
ar670w|\
ar725w|\
rt-n15|\
ar670w|\
ar725w|\
rt-n15|\
@@
-112,18
+132,20
@@
ramips_setup_interfaces()
atp-52b|\
awm002-evb|\
awm003-evb|\
atp-52b|\
awm002-evb|\
awm003-evb|\
+ c20i|\
+ c50|\
dir-645|\
dir-860l-b1|\
dir-645|\
dir-860l-b1|\
- f5d8235-v1|\
f5d8235-v2|\
gl-mt300a|\
gl-mt300n|\
gl-mt750|\
hg255d|\
f5d8235-v2|\
gl-mt300a|\
gl-mt300n|\
gl-mt750|\
hg255d|\
- mzk-wdpr|\
jhr-n805r|\
jhr-n825r|\
jhr-n926r|\
jhr-n805r|\
jhr-n825r|\
jhr-n926r|\
+ mzk-wdpr|\
+ rb750gr3|\
rt-n14u|\
ubnt-erx|\
ur-326n4g|\
rt-n14u|\
ubnt-erx|\
ur-326n4g|\
@@
-152,8
+174,7
@@
ramips_setup_interfaces()
ucidef_add_switch "switch0" \
"1:lan" "2:lan" "3:lan" "4:lan" "0:wan" "9@eth0"
;;
ucidef_add_switch "switch0" \
"1:lan" "2:lan" "3:lan" "4:lan" "0:wan" "9@eth0"
;;
- cf-wr800n|\
- ex2700)
+ cf-wr800n)
ucidef_add_switch "switch0" \
"4:lan" "6t@eth0"
;;
ucidef_add_switch "switch0" \
"4:lan" "6t@eth0"
;;
@@
-163,14
+184,22
@@
ramips_setup_interfaces()
;;
cs-qr10|\
d105|\
;;
cs-qr10|\
d105|\
+ dch-m225|\
+ ex2700|\
hpm|\
mzk-ex300np|\
mzk-ex750np|\
na930|\
hpm|\
mzk-ex300np|\
mzk-ex750np|\
na930|\
+ pbr-d1|\
wli-tx4-ag300n|\
wli-tx4-ag300n|\
+ wmr-300|\
wrh-300cr)
ucidef_set_interface_lan "eth0"
;;
wrh-300cr)
ucidef_set_interface_lan "eth0"
;;
+ duzun-dm06)
+ ucidef_add_switch "switch0" \
+ "1:lan" "0:wan" "6@eth0"
+ ;;
e1700|\
mt7620a_mt7530)
ucidef_add_switch "switch1" \
e1700|\
mt7620a_mt7530)
ucidef_add_switch "switch1" \
@@
-181,26
+210,53
@@
ramips_setup_interfaces()
ucidef_add_switch "switch0" \
"1:lan" "2:lan" "3:lan" "4:lan" "5:lan" "0:wan" "6@eth0"
;;
ucidef_add_switch "switch0" \
"1:lan" "2:lan" "3:lan" "4:lan" "5:lan" "0:wan" "6@eth0"
;;
+ kn_rc|\
+ kn_rf)
+ ucidef_add_switch "switch" \
+ "0:wan" "1:lan" "2:lan" "3:lan" "4:lan" "6@eth0"
+ ;;
+ kng_rc)
+ ucidef_add_switch "switch1" \
+ "0:lan" "1:lan" "2:lan" "3:lan" "4:wan" "7t@eth0"
+ ;;
mlwg2|\
wizard8800|\
mlwg2|\
wizard8800|\
- wl-330n|\
- wmr-300)
+ wl-330n)
ucidef_set_interface_lan "eth0.1"
;;
ucidef_set_interface_lan "eth0.1"
;;
+ mr200)
+ ucidef_add_switch "switch0" \
+ "0:lan" "1:lan" "2:lan" "3:lan" "6t@eth0"
+ ucidef_set_interface_wan "usb0"
+ ;;
mzk-dp150n|\
vocore)
ucidef_add_switch "switch0" \
"0:lan" "4:lan" "6t@eth0"
;;
mzk-dp150n|\
vocore)
ucidef_add_switch "switch0" \
"0:lan" "4:lan" "6t@eth0"
;;
+ newifi-d1)
+ ucidef_set_interface_lan_wan "eth0.1" "eth0.2"
+ ucidef_add_switch "switch0" \
+ "0:lan" "1:lan" "2:lan" "3:lan" "5:wan" "6t@eth0" "7t@eth0"
+ ucidef_add_switch "switch1" \
+ "4:lan" "6t@eth0" "7t@eth0"
+ ;;
rt-n56u)
ucidef_add_switch "switch0" \
"0:lan" "1:lan" "2:lan" "3:lan" "4:wan" "8@eth0"
;;
tew-691gr|\
rt-n56u)
ucidef_add_switch "switch0" \
"0:lan" "1:lan" "2:lan" "3:lan" "4:wan" "8@eth0"
;;
tew-691gr|\
- tew-692gr)
+ tew-692gr|\
+ wlr-6000)
ucidef_add_switch "switch0" \
"1:lan" "2:lan" "3:lan" "4:lan" "5:wan" "0@eth0"
;;
ucidef_add_switch "switch0" \
"1:lan" "2:lan" "3:lan" "4:lan" "5:wan" "0@eth0"
;;
+ vocore2)
+ ucidef_add_switch "switch0" \
+ "0:lan" "2:lan" "6t@eth0"
+ ;;
+ f5d8235-v1|\
+ tew-714tru|\
v11st-fe|\
wzr-agl300nh)
ucidef_add_switch "switch0" \
v11st-fe|\
wzr-agl300nh)
ucidef_add_switch "switch0" \
@@
-218,11
+274,6
@@
ramips_setup_interfaces()
ucidef_add_switch "switch0" \
"1:lan" "2:lan" "0:wan" "6@eth0"
;;
ucidef_add_switch "switch0" \
"1:lan" "2:lan" "0:wan" "6@eth0"
;;
- zbt-we826|\
- zbt-wr8305rt)
- ucidef_add_switch "switch0" \
- "0:lan" "1:lan" "2:lan" "3:lan" "4:wan" "6@eth0"
- ;;
*)
RT3X5X=`cat /proc/cpuinfo | egrep "(RT3.5|RT5350)"`
if [ -n "${RT3X5X}" ]; then
*)
RT3X5X=`cat /proc/cpuinfo | egrep "(RT3.5|RT5350)"`
if [ -n "${RT3X5X}" ]; then
@@
-275,10
+326,17
@@
ramips_setup_macs()
wan_mac=$(mtd_get_mac_binary devdata 7)
;;
cy-swr1100|\
wan_mac=$(mtd_get_mac_binary devdata 7)
;;
cy-swr1100|\
+ dch-m225)
+ lan_mac=$(mtd_get_mac_ascii factory lanmac)
+ ;;
dir-645)
lan_mac=$(mtd_get_mac_ascii nvram lanmac)
wan_mac=$(mtd_get_mac_ascii nvram wanmac)
;;
dir-645)
lan_mac=$(mtd_get_mac_ascii nvram lanmac)
wan_mac=$(mtd_get_mac_ascii nvram wanmac)
;;
+ dir-860l-b1)
+ lan_mac=$(mtd_get_mac_ascii factory lanmac)
+ wan_mac=$(mtd_get_mac_ascii factory wanmac)
+ ;;
e1700)
wan_mac=$(mtd_get_mac_ascii config WAN_MAC_ADDR)
;;
e1700)
wan_mac=$(mtd_get_mac_ascii config WAN_MAC_ADDR)
;;
@@
-287,11
+345,18
@@
ramips_setup_macs()
[ -n "$lan_mac" ] || lan_mac=$(cat /sys/class/net/eth0/address)
wan_mac=$(macaddr_add "$lan_mac" 1)
;;
[ -n "$lan_mac" ] || lan_mac=$(cat /sys/class/net/eth0/address)
wan_mac=$(macaddr_add "$lan_mac" 1)
;;
+ kng_rc)
+ wan_mac=$(mtd_get_mac_binary factory 28)
+ ;;
linkits7688 | \
linkits7688d)
wan_mac=$(mtd_get_mac_binary factory 4)
lan_mac=$(mtd_get_mac_binary factory 46)
;;
linkits7688 | \
linkits7688d)
wan_mac=$(mtd_get_mac_binary factory 4)
lan_mac=$(mtd_get_mac_binary factory 46)
;;
+ mac1200rv2)
+ lan_mac=$(mtd_get_mac_binary factory_info 13)
+ wan_mac=$(macaddr_add "$lan_mac" 1)
+ ;;
m3|\
m4|\
x5|\
m3|\
m4|\
x5|\
@@
-299,6
+364,15
@@
ramips_setup_macs()
lan_mac=$(cat /sys/class/net/eth0/address)
lan_mac=$(macaddr_add "$lan_mac" -2)
;;
lan_mac=$(cat /sys/class/net/eth0/address)
lan_mac=$(macaddr_add "$lan_mac" -2)
;;
+ newifi-d1)
+ lan_mac=$(cat /sys/class/net/eth0/address)
+ lan_mac=$(macaddr_add "$lan_mac" 2)
+ ;;
+ omega2|\
+ omega2p)
+ wan_mac=$(mtd_get_mac_binary factory 4)
+ lan_mac=$(mtd_get_mac_binary factory 46)
+ ;;
oy-0001)
lan_mac=$(mtd_get_mac_binary factory 40)
wan_mac=$(mtd_get_mac_binary factory 46)
oy-0001)
lan_mac=$(mtd_get_mac_binary factory 40)
wan_mac=$(mtd_get_mac_binary factory 46)
@@
-312,17
+386,19
@@
ramips_setup_macs()
wan_mac=$(mtd_get_mac_binary factory 57350)
;;
tew-691gr)
wan_mac=$(mtd_get_mac_binary factory 57350)
;;
tew-691gr)
- lan_mac=$(cat /sys/class/net/eth0/address)
- wan_mac=$(macaddr_add "$lan_mac" 3)
+ wan_mac=$(macaddr_add "$(mtd_get_mac_binary factory 4)" 3)
;;
tew-692gr)
;;
tew-692gr)
- lan_mac=$(cat /sys/class/net/eth0/address)
- wan_mac=$(macaddr_add "$lan_mac" 4)
+ wan_mac=$(macaddr_add "$(mtd_get_mac_binary factory 4)" 1)
;;
tiny-ac)
lan_mac=$(mtd_get_mac_ascii u-boot-env LAN_MAC_ADDR)
wan_mac=$(mtd_get_mac_ascii u-boot-env WAN_MAC_ADDR)
;;
;;
tiny-ac)
lan_mac=$(mtd_get_mac_ascii u-boot-env LAN_MAC_ADDR)
wan_mac=$(mtd_get_mac_ascii u-boot-env WAN_MAC_ADDR)
;;
+ vr500)
+ lan_mac=$(mtd_get_mac_binary factory 57344)
+ wan_mac=$(mtd_get_mac_binary factory 57350)
+ ;;
w306r-v20)
lan_mac=$(cat /sys/class/net/eth0/address)
wan_mac=$(macaddr_add "$lan_mac" 5)
w306r-v20)
lan_mac=$(cat /sys/class/net/eth0/address)
wan_mac=$(macaddr_add "$lan_mac" 5)
@@
-341,6
+417,9
@@
ramips_setup_macs()
lan_mac=$(mtd_get_mac_binary factory 4)
wan_mac=$(mtd_get_mac_binary factory 40)
;;
lan_mac=$(mtd_get_mac_binary factory 4)
wan_mac=$(mtd_get_mac_binary factory 40)
;;
+ wlr-6000)
+ wan_mac=$(macaddr_add "$(mtd_get_mac_binary factory 32772)" 2)
+ ;;
wsr-1166)
local index="$(find_mtd_index "board_data")"
wan_mac="$(grep -m1 mac= "/dev/mtd${index}" | cut -d= -f2)"
wsr-1166)
local index="$(find_mtd_index "board_data")"
wan_mac="$(grep -m1 mac= "/dev/mtd${index}" | cut -d= -f2)"
@@
-352,8
+431,8
@@
ramips_setup_macs()
;;
esac
;;
esac
- [ -n "$lan_mac" ] && ucidef_set_interface_macaddr
lan
$lan_mac
- [ -n "$wan_mac" ] && ucidef_set_interface_macaddr
wan
$wan_mac
+ [ -n "$lan_mac" ] && ucidef_set_interface_macaddr
"lan"
$lan_mac
+ [ -n "$wan_mac" ] && ucidef_set_interface_macaddr
"wan"
$wan_mac
}
board_config_update
}
board_config_update